Jared Fogle Jared Fogle

Indiana University graduate, Jared Fogle, lost 245 pounds using what he calls "The Subway Diet." At the age of 22, Fogle weighed 425 pounds and was not happy with the way he looked. Fogle recently started The Jared Fogle Foundation in hopes to educate in the prevention of childhood obesity.

Madieu Williams Madieu Williams

Considered one of the best safeties in the NFL, Cincinnati Bengals player Madieu Williams fled his home in war-torn Sierra Leone to later find success in professional football. He leverages this success to raise awareness for minority health issues in addition to maintaining the Madieu Williams Foundation for youth.
